The statement that best describes political contributions individuals can make to candidates is: "Political contributions are a constitutionally protected form of free expression."

This reflects the understanding that political contributions are considered a way of expressing support for candidates and their ideas, and thus are protected under the First Amendment of the U.S. Constitution. However, it is important to note that while contributions are protected, there are still regulations and limits imposed by federal and state laws on the amounts individuals can contribute to political campaigns.
